SXSW is seeking a Seasonal Client Events Coordinator who will work directly with the Partner Operations, Project Manager, and other internal stakeholders to develop a top-line knowledge of all internal tracking systems for official client events, including, but not limited to, leading the advancement of official events, tentpole events (opening/closing parties), happy hours, track receptions, private dinners, etc.

Duties & Responsibilities
  • Conduct outreach to clients, venues, and vendors to support event execution.
  • Review and catalog client deliverables to track requirements.
  • Execute event planning tasks, data entry, and Airtable record updates.
  • Manage guest list outreach, administration, invoices, and payments for happy hours and track receptions.
  • Coordinate with the Government Affairs team on event permitting requirements.
  • Organize client site plans, assets, and documentation for centralized access ahead of internal and external deadlines.
  • Maintain thorough and accurate tracking processes for the Project Manager, Commercial Product, and Client Events.
  • Communicate regularly with the Project Manager, keeping informed on all venues, lounges, and activation details for Sales clients.
On‑Site Responsibilities
  • Maintain communication with the Client Liaisons acting as SXSW representatives at official Sales and Sponsor client venues, lounges, and activations.
  • Assist with client load‑in, patrol assigned areas to maintain oversight, and ensure all client needs are met.
  • Meet regularly with the Client Events team to discuss problems and solutions.
  • Maintain on‑site tracking documents for events, including client production and activation tracking, primary client and vendor contact lists, day‑by‑day event schedules, and other relevant information as needed.
  • Familiarize yourself with the Client Events internal tracking documents (Airtable, Google Docs, and FileMaker), and be able to search them to answer questions quickly and accurately.

Work Location & Schedule

The position is located in Austin, Texas. Core business office hours are from 10 am to 6 pm, Monday through Friday. However, from January through March, you must be available to work additional hours, including evenings and weekends, and possibly stay downtown during the event.
